Grep, awk и sed – это мощные инструменты в Unix/Linux, применяемые для работы с текстом. У каждой утилиты свои особенности, хотя иногда их функции пересекаются. grep – Ищет строки, соответствующие заданному шаблону (обычно регулярному выражению). Выводит найденные строки или их части, фильтруя текст. Примеры: grep "error" log.txt (Поиск строк с "error"). grep -i "warning" log.txt (Игнорировать регистр). sed – Потоковый редактор, заменяет, удаляет и изменяет текст на основе шаблонов. Работает построчно, может обрабатывать многострочные паттерны, быстро редактируя файлы. Примеры: sed 's/apple/orange/' file.txt (Заменить "apple" на "orange"). sed '/DEBUG/d' file.txt (Удалить строки с "DEBUG"). awk – Анализирует и обрабатывает текст, извлекая данные, обрабатывая поля и манипулируя текстом. Выполняет арифметические операции, фильтрацию и форматирование, используя колонки для обработки данных. Примеры: awk '{print 1, 3}' file.txt (Вывести 1-й и 3-й столбцы). awk '$3 > 50 {print